The cheapest way to get from La Mesa to Solana Beach is to drive which costs $4 - $7 and takes 28 min.
The fastest way to get from La Mesa to Solana Beach is to drive which takes 28 min and costs $4 - $7.
No, there is no direct bus from La Mesa to Solana Beach. However, there are services departing from La Mesa Bl & Culowee St and arriving at Hwy 101 & Dahlia Dr via Fashion Valley Transit Center and Gilman Dr & Myers Dr.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 55m.
No, there is no direct train from La Mesa station to Solana Beach station. However, there are services departing from Grossmont Station and arriving at Solana Beach Amtrak Station via San Diego Old Town Transportation Center.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 56m.
The distance between La Mesa and Solana Beach is 35 miles. The road distance is 25.2 miles.
The best way to get from La Mesa to Solana Beach without a car is to tram and train which takes 1h 56m and costs $9 - $30.
It takes approximately 1h 56m to get from La Mesa to Solana Beach, including transfers.
